Book excerpt: Spinel ferrite thin films are promising candidates for high frequency applications due to their remarkable electrical and magnetic properties. Cobalt ferrite thin films have gained widespread interests in the applications of magneto-optical recording due to their large perpendicular magneto-crystalline anisotropy. The addition of non-magnetic Cr3+ ions could produce sufficient changes in the structure of cobalt ferrite. In order to achieve homogeneous cobalt chromium ferrite (CoCr0.5Fe1.7O4) thin films, various techniques such as electron beam evaporation, pulsed laser deposition (PLD), sol-gel, dip coating and spray pyrolysis have been developed. The deposition of CoCr0.5Fe1.7O4 thin films by electron beam evaporation technique is the focus of this book. This book also covers the effect of annealing temperature on structural, surface morphological, magnetic and optical properties of cobalt chromium ferrite thin films. It is noted that Ms and Hc increases with annealing temperature. Band gap energy and optical constants (n, k, ) decreases and increases with temperature indicative of good quality of thin films.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Data is of great importance to man and needs to be stored reliably such that it can be called upon and used at any time. Man has progressed over the years from relying on the brain as a data storage system to magnetic recording systems. Magnetic data storage consists of non-volatile memories (longitudinal or perpendicular recording media) where the information is stored. The perpendicular recording system has become the popular choice in recent times due to its ultra-high storage capacity. n this work we study magnetic thin film of Cobalt ferrite with in-plane and out-of-plane anisotropies as longitudinal and perpendicular media respectively. Different types of magnetic characterization were performed on the samples of interest through VSM and torque measurements. This study shows that films with perpendicular anisotropy are more magnetically stable than those with in-plane anisotropy due to their slow magnetic relaxation. The slow relaxation process is promoted through the demagnetizing field induced by the measurement geometry, which considerably reduces the irreversible magnetic susceptibility making perpendicular recording more suited for magnetic data storage. -- Abstract.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Co/Pd and Co/Pd artificial lattice films have attracted much interest by their special magnetization properties. We discussed the effect of the Pt, Pd layer thickness on the magnetic anisotropy, and we showed the effect of the hydrogen ion implantation on the magnetic properties of multi-layered films. The Co/Pt and Co/Pd multi-layered films were formed on Si(111) substrates with molecular beam epitaxy. We did structure analysis, magnetic domain analysis and magnetic properties evaluation with XRD, MFM and VSM, respectively. Among the series of films of 0.4 nm Co layer, XRD showed that the film of 1.0 nm Pt layer had a highest periodicity and that they had (111) plane orientation completely. The magnetic domain size reduced with the increase of the thickness of Pt layer. We found out that the coercivity decreased linearly as a function of the length of magnetic domain wall in the unit area. The result of VSM showed that the multi-layered films of Pt thickness of less than 2.8 nm had perpendicular magnetic anisotropy. The perpendicular anisotropy energy changed by the nonmagnetic layer thickness and had a maximum value for 0.4 nm Co 0.4 nm/nonmagnetic metal 1.0 nm multi-layered film. After hydrogen implantation into the films, XRD showed that the lattice spacing was swelled with hydrogen dose. Also, MFM observed that the magnetic domain size reduced with the increase of the hydrogen dose. The easy axis of magnetization changed from perpendicular to parallel in the plane with the increase of the hydrogen dose. After evacuation of hydrogen at 473 K, perpendicular anisotropy was partially recovered. This phenomenon suggested that the origin of magnetic anisotropy was mainly the lattice mismatch and distortion in the layer interface. But Co/Pd film was not recovered by this thermal treatment. This means that Pd made stable hydride and did not evacuate hydrogen at this temperature.
